在使用v2ray进行网络代理时,用户可能会遇到“failed to read udp msg”的错误信息。这一问题不仅影响用户的使用体验,也阻碍了网络连接的顺畅。本文将详细探讨该错误的原因、解决方案以及相关常见问题解答。
什么是v2ray?
v2ray是一个用于网络代理的开源工具,支持多种协议,如VMess、Shadowsocks、Trojan等。它能够实现快速、稳定的网络连接,并广泛应用于翻墙和科学上网。由于其强大的功能和灵活的配置,v2ray成为了众多用户的首选代理工具。
“failed to read udp msg”错误解析
“failed to read udp msg”错误通常表示v2ray在尝试读取UDP消息时出现了问题。UDP(用户数据报协议)是一种不需要建立连接的网络协议,常用于实时应用和视频通话等场景。出现此错误可能由以下几种原因造成:
1. 网络连接不稳定
- 如果网络连接不稳定,可能会导致UDP数据包丢失,进而引发该错误。
- 请确保您的网络环境良好,尤其是使用公共Wi-Fi时,更需小心。
2. v2ray配置错误
- 配置文件中的错误或不当设置可能导致UDP消息无法正常读取。
- 请仔细检查v2ray的配置文件,确保每个参数都正确无误。
3. 防火墙或安全软件干扰
- 某些防火墙或安全软件可能会阻止UDP流量,导致该错误的出现。
- 关闭防火墙或调整其设置可能有助于解决问题。
4. 服务器端问题
- 服务器端的问题,如服务未正常运行或配置错误,也可能导致客户端无法读取UDP消息。
- 检查服务器状态,确保其运行正常。
解决“failed to read udp msg”错误的步骤
针对上述原因,用户可以尝试以下解决方案:
1. 检查网络连接
- 使用ping命令测试网络连接的稳定性,确认无丢包现象。
- 尝试更换网络环境,如切换到有线网络或更稳定的Wi-Fi。
2. 重新配置v2ray
- 打开v2ray的配置文件,检查所有设置,包括IP地址、端口号、协议类型等。
- 确保UDP流量已正确配置,具体参考v2ray的官方文档。
3. 调整防火墙设置
- 临时关闭防火墙,检查是否能够正常使用UDP消息。
- 如果关闭防火墙后问题解决,建议在防火墙中添加v2ray的例外规则。
4. 检查服务器状态
- 使用SSH等工具登录到服务器,检查v2ray是否正常运行。
- 如果有必要,重启v2ray服务并查看相关日志,确保无错误信息。
常见问题解答(FAQ)
1. v2ray是什么?
v2ray是一款功能强大的网络代理工具,旨在提高用户的网络访问速度和隐私保护。它支持多种协议,并具备灵活的配置选项。
2. “failed to read udp msg”有什么影响?
该错误会导致用户无法正常接收UDP数据包,从而影响视频通话、在线游戏等实时应用的体验。
3. 如何查看v2ray的运行日志?
用户可以在v2ray的配置文件中启用日志记录功能,并指定日志文件的存储路径。通过查看日志文件,用户可以获得详细的错误信息和运行状态。
4. 如果我不懂技术,是否能解决这个问题?
如果不熟悉技术,建议寻求网络专业人士的帮助,或者在相关论坛和社区中发帖询问,通常会有经验丰富的用户提供解决方案。
5. 其他常见的v2ray错误有哪些?
其他常见错误包括“connection refused”、“failed to dial”等,通常与网络环境或配置有关。用户可参考官方文档或社区寻求解决办法。
结论
“failed to read udp msg”错误是v2ray用户常见的问题之一,但通过对网络连接、v2ray配置、系统安全设置等进行全面检查,用户通常能够找到合适的解决方案。希望本文能帮助您解决该问题,并顺利享受v2ray带来的高效网络体验。